G a tanker has developed a leak in pristine bay and has spilled a considerable amount of oil. the good news is that oil-eating b

acteria are eating the oil at the rate of 5 cubic feet per hour. the slick is in the shape of a cylinder, whose height is the thickness of the slick. when the radius of the cylinder is 500 feet, the thickness of the slick is 0.01 ft, and is decreasing at the rate of 0.001 ft/hr.
Mathematics
1 answer:
alexandr402 [8]4 years ago
7 0
V = \pi r^2 h \\  \\ \frac{dV}{dt} = 2\pi r h \frac{dr}{dt} + \pi r^2 \frac{dh}{dt}  \\  \\ -5 =2 \pi (500)(.01)\frac{dr}{dt} + \pi (500^2)(-.001) \\  \\ \frac{dr}{dt} = \frac{250 \pi -5}{10 \pi} = \frac{50 \pi - 1}{2 \pi}

Complete the general form equation of the parabola that passes through (4, -11) with vertex at : (2, -3).
fomenos

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

You're given a coordinate in the form of (x, y) and you're also given the vertex in the form of (h, k). We will use those in the vertex form of the equation

y=a(x-h)^2+k and solve for a. Filling in:

-11=a(4-2)^2-3 which simplifies a bit to

-11=a(2)^2-3 and a bit more to

-11=4a-3. Add 3 to both sides to get

-8 = 4a so

a = -2

The equation, then, is

y=-2(x-2)^2-3
